The Crypto.com Formula 1 Miami Grand Prix returns May 1–3, 2026, with a sprint weekend format packed with practice, qualifying, the big race, fan zones, concerts, and celeb sightings. Over 80,000 fans flood in, but from the water you’re in your own VIP bubble.
